With Black Lives Matter protests happening all over America for the past week in reaction to the frequent, unaccountable murders of Black people by the police, there has been a concurrent push to celebrate Black lives through art and appreciate the contributions that Black people make to American culture.
One such area of culture is film, where Black directors have made incredible features and documentaries, many of which have changed the world.
There's a study that shows reading fiction builds empathy. I don't know if watching movies works in the same way, but I think it's fair to assume that it doesn't make you less empathetic.
